Imagine boating to the nearest village for food only to discover on your return, you can’t find the boat.

If you’re one of the Lake Tanganyika locals who depend on this transport boat to get home, it could be a treacherous walk just getting to the boat. Wading through muddy water, carrying your heavy food purchase in large bucket on your head or being disabled or sick, adds a new dilemma to the shopping or doctor visit with the transport boat.

Your safety concerns are not over until you reach and sit on the boat without losing your balance or belongings because this transport boat doesn’t come with a dock.
